| Neighborhood communication is a basic need in urban life, especially in contemporary Chinese society, where rapid urbanization, high-rise aggregative apartment buildings and estrangement between neighbors make it even more imperative as one of the way for residents to maintain relations and ease tension. Neighborhood communication space is frequently used semi-public activity space that is closely related to daily life. Its effectiveness, therefore, should be emphasized by architects.The thesis tries to sort out major reasons for neighborhood communication failure through collection and classification of survey cases and existing documented cases on the basis of field survey and existing research materials, as well as architectural, environmental-psychological and sociological theories. It also proposes design methodologies and other recommendations from the perspectives of space measurement, spatial sense of belonging, rims of spaces and space multivalence, with a view to designing more effective neighborhood communication spaces and providing references for future community design. |
